Personal and Family Information

Hugh was born about 1452, the son of Robert Hesketh and Alice Booth. The place is not known.

He died after 1511. The place is not known.

Catalogue description Final Concord : for £20 : Hugh Heskeath and Hugh Matewe, chaplains, plaintiffs and...

Reference: DDHE 22/39

Description:

Final Concord : for £20 : Hugh Heskeath and Hugh Matewe, chaplains, plaintiffs and Richard Nutshawe, deforceant -- 3 messuages, 60ac. land, 20ac. meadow, 100ac. pasture in Hoton, Hogwik, and Longton

Date: 17 Aug. 1506

Catalogue description Quitclaim : Joan Cuntclyff, widow of Ralph Nutshawe of Hoghwyk, gent. and John their...

Reference: DDHE 60/33

Description:

Quitclaim : Joan Cuntclyff, widow of Ralph Nutshawe of Hoghwyk, gent. and John their son, to Richard Hesketh, gent., Hugh Hesketh and Hugh Mathewe, chaplains -- properties in Hoghwyk, Hoton, and Longton -- Seal.

Date: 24 Aug. 1511
